What Locals Say about Bernville

  • Kimberly Carranza
    "Safe neighborhood quite well maintained few schools nearby. Neighbors seem friendly. Some kids will help shovel snow. Neighborhood is very friendly a lot of kids come to trick or treat. For the holidays there is Christmas village not far great for family outing "
  • Jamie O.
    "Quiet neighborhood, but close enough to shopping and other necessities. People are friendly and look out for each other. "
  • William P.
    "It’s quiet and safe. People are friendly. I have 2 young children who are both in sports and other activities. Because of this I have probably met everyone in our small community. It’s amazing how many times you run into someone from another event when your out and about."
  • Rachel
    "No dog parks near by but blue marsh is only a mile up the road and you can walk dogs without a leash on those trails. I see lots of people walking there dogs in Bernville. "
  • Rachel
    "Pet friendly town, we see people walking their dogs often. I don’t own a dog so I’m not sure what they are looking for beyond that. "
  • Iness0310
    "Super quiet town, to live and relax love it. walking distance to community park and pool. own Police station fire Department always patrolling furthermore we have curfew hours super safe. been living here for six years and happy "
  • Ann S.
    "This is a wonderful area for all walks of life. This area is comprised safe and quiet communities. Tulpehocken is a great school district, with many opportunities for students. Bernville is located close to 78 and the bustling area Reading and Wyomissing. "
